#4a855f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4a855f is composed of 29% red, 52.2%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.6%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 141.4 degrees, a saturation of 28.5% and a lightness of 40.6%. #4a855f color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ffbe with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#4a855f color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an - lime green.

#4a855f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4a855f has RGB values of R:74, G:133,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 4883807.

Shades and Tints of #4a855f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040705 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a855f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626d66 is the less saturated color, while #02cd4a is the most saturated one.
